Possible Causes of Black Mold Growth

One common cause of black mold in Scott homes and businesses is plumbing leaks. Small leaks behind walls or under sinks can go unnoticed for weeks or months, providing a continuous moisture source for mold growth. Flooding and water intrusion from storms can also lead to extensive mold problems, especially if affected areas are not dried quickly and thoroughly.

Additionally, poor ventilation and high humidity levels contribute significantly to black mold development. Homes with inadequate airflow create ideal conditions for mold spores to settle and multiply. Attics, basements, and bathrooms are especially vulnerable spots where moisture tends to accumulate. Recognizing these causes helps in maintaining a dry environment and preventing the proliferation of black mold in your property.

How We Can Fix That

Our experts begin by conducting a thorough inspection to identify all areas affected by black mold. We utilize advanced moisture detection tools to locate hidden growths and assess the extent of contamination. This detailed assessment ensures we target the root cause of the problem and prevent future issues.

Once the affected areas are identified, we employ specialized mold removal techniques and high-efficiency air filtration to eliminate mold spores safely. Our remediation process includes safely containing contaminated zones to prevent cross-contamination and removing porous materials that can harbor mold, such as drywall, carpet, and insulation. We take extra precautions to protect your health and minimize disruption during the process.

After removing mold and contaminated materials, we thoroughly clean and disinfect the area using EPA-approved solutions. To prevent recurrence, our team also addresses moisture issues by fixing leaks, improving ventilation, and installing dehumidifiers if necessary. Frequently Asked Questions

How quickly can mold start growing after water damage?

Mold can begin to grow within 24 to 48 hours after water exposure. That’s why prompt cleanup and moisture control are essential to prevent mold from developing in your property.

Is black mold dangerous to my health?

Yes, black mold can cause allergic reactions, respiratory issues, and other health problems, especially in sensitive individuals, children, and pets. Professional removal is crucial for safety.

How can I prevent black mold from returning?

Maintaining low humidity levels, fixing leaks immediately, and ensuring proper ventilation are key steps to prevent mold recurrence. Regular inspections also help catch issues early.
